Shree Gangour Restaurant

Shree Gangour Restaurant is explicitly marketed as a 100% Jain & pure vegetarian restaurant, which means no meat, fish, or eggs are used in the kitchen. This makes it structurally safe for vegetarians. However, the venue appears to be permanently closed, so confirm before relying on it if it reopens.

Egg-free

confidence 30% ·

Limited information, Thin positive signal only: a stray menu callout, a single passing review mention, or generic dietary marketing without specifics. Not enough to assess kitchen practice. Call ahead and confirm before relying on it.

Jain cuisine traditionally excludes eggs, and the restaurant's 100% Jain claim suggests an egg-free kitchen. However, the only source is an aggregator page that does not explicitly confirm the absence of eggs in all dishes. Call ahead to verify if the kitchen is entirely egg-free.
